1) to kick, kick at 1a) (Qal) 1a1) to kick 1a2) to kick at 1a3) to desire (fig.)
STRONG'S WORD STUDY
H1163 — בָּעַט
ba.at · to kick · Hebrew/Aramaic
2 tagged verse occurrences
Deuteronomy 32:15 · וַיִּבְעָ֔טAnd Jeshurun waxeth fat, and doth kick: Thou hast been fat—thou hast been thick, Thou hast been covered. And he leaveth God who made him, And dishonoureth the Rock of his salvation.1 Samuel 2:29 · תִבְעֲט֗וּWhy do ye kick at My sacrifice, and at Mine offering which I commanded in My habitation, and dost honour thy sons above Me, to make yourselves fat from the first part of every offering of Israel, of My people?
